An expandable imaging trailer combines diagnostic imaging capability with hydraulic pop-out walls that extend the operational footprint — providing the shielded imaging room, control console, patient preparation bay and recovery space that fixed-site imaging requires, on a road-deployable platform that drives between sites. structmod expandable imaging trailers serve healthcare imaging programmes where outreach combines high-end imaging modality with extended clinical workflow — diabetic retinopathy screening with imaging support, oncology screening programmes, hospital imaging during scanner replacement, and disaster response imaging surge.

Standard configurations integrate the imaging modality (CT, MRI, X-ray, or specialty imaging) at the trailer's centre with appropriate shielding (lead per NCRP Report 147 for CT/X-ray, RF cage per OEM specification for MRI), pop-out walls extending patient preparation, control console workspace and recovery bay laterally. The expanded operational floor area accommodates patient flow management that fixed-width imaging trailers cannot provide — proper pre-imaging consultation room, separate changing cubicles, accessible patient transfer for scanner positioning, and recovery space for post-contrast monitoring. Vibration management for the scanner combines with chassis stabilisation and acoustic isolation from external road traffic.

structmod expandable imaging trailers serve regional cancer screening programmes (where diagnostic-grade imaging plus extended patient workflow matter for screening quality), hospital imaging programmes during scanner replacement or department refurbishment, specialty imaging fleets covering rural populations, and disaster response imaging surge during major events. Lead time is 14-18 weeks from contract signature; OEM scanner integration adds 2-6 weeks. Compliance covers IEC 60601 medical electrical safety, NCRP Report 147 shielding, OEM scanner certification, and DOT/E-mark vehicle homologation.

Secuencia de despliegue típica

  1. Hora 0 — el remolque llega en el vehículo tractor, se posiciona y calza
  2. Hora 0–1 — gatos estabilizadores desplegados, nivelación verificada
  3. Hora 1–2 — paredes hidráulicas o extensiones desplegadas donde aplique
  4. Hora 2–3 — conexiones de servicios (electricidad, agua, aguas residuales)
  5. Hora 3–4 — prueba funcional según protocolo FAT
  6. Hora 4 — entrega operacional con formación de usuarios
ESPECIFICACIÓN TÉCNICA

Spec sheet — STR-2621

Longitud total14.1 m · 46.3 ft
Anchura (transporte)2,55 m
Anchura (desplegado)7.50 m
Altura (transporte)3.20 m
Superficie (desplegado)105.8 m²
Peso en seco11.1 t
ChasisAcero laminado en caliente EN 10025 S355JR · EN 1090 EXC-2
Calidad de soldaduraEN ISO 3834-3
EnvolventePanel sándwich, núcleo PIR 80 mm · λ ≈ 0,023 W/(m·K)
Resistencia al fuegoEI-30 · ensayado según EN 13501-2
SueloContrachapado marino sobre EPDM · clasificación antideslizante R-10
Instalación eléctrica120/240 V · 60 Hz (especificación EE.UU.) · conforme IEC 60364
ClimatizaciónUnidad compacta de cubierta · MERV-13
Rango de operación−25 °C a +50 °C ambiente
Clasificación de vientoDiseñado para viento básico de 150 km/h (EN 1991-1-4)
TransporteHuella ISO 668 · apto para placa CSC (variantes contenedor)
Tiempo de montaje3 horas · equipo de 2 personas

Full drawings, calculation notes, DoP, O&M manual and FAT report included with every unit. Specs indicative — configurable to project requirements.
